Transaction aebd98ebefc450e14256ca5485a921a68fd74c2e9ab5d07eea7881df95bf6798
1 Input
1 Output
-
aebd98ebefc450e14256ca5485a921a68fd74c2e9ab5d07eea7881df95bf6798:0
- value
- 124210622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c141e65557837dcc53b8f88b2efc5717230bbd OP_EQUAL
- address
- 3B4LMsVrQopLGMSRsxwoViKtDDSYt9tRXG